IPA: /nɒŋˈɡeɪ/
KK: /nɔŋˈɡeɪ/
Describing someone or something that is not attracted to the same sex.
He identifies as nongay and is attracted to women.
A person who does not identify as gay.
He identifies as nongay and prefers to date women.
This word originates from the prefix 'non-' (meaning not) and 'gay' (from Old French 'gai', meaning joyful or carefree). The term 'nongay' refers to something that is not gay or does not pertain to the characteristics associated with being gay.
